where can you buy 280 brass that is not nickle plated? And why do they Plate it? It seems that there is no problem finding any other cal. in plain Brass. I need to fireform some more 280AI and I do not want to use nickle plated Brass. I found a place on line that advertised 280 Brass. I ordered 600 rounds, when it arrived today I opened the box and it was nickle plated. Whats up with all the 280 brass that is available being nickle plated? You would think the would say it is nickle plated. Any suggestions???

Was it Winchester or Federal brand or Remington brand?
I have found Remington usually does not plate their 280 brass but Winchester and Federal do. You can still fire form them. I have for my 280AI and they are fine. Or send them back and get regular brass.

I know I can still use them, but the nickle plate is not as good for reloading. The nickle comes off and can get in the dies. Would much rather find regular Brass and not have to worry about it. It is winchester brass. I just cant seem to find any Rem. Brass anywhere. If someone can share a web site or some info on where to get Regular plain ol Brass it would be very helpful.

Personally, I hate nickel brass. It chips on the case mouth and is very hard on trimmers. If you are going to work your brass, stay away from it.

The only application I can think of is maybe coastal Alaska where you might be worried about salt corrosion and had not intention of reloading the cases.

Maybe you can use 270W if you can't find what you want in 280? In any case, I'd return it, I have no use for it. Well, I have some, but I toss them. Pistol cases are fine, not bottle neck.
